Transaction 3420cac454d951cedc64012ce0e37feb3d0e779029c84cc634720dc6db3232ba
1 Input
1 Output
-
3420cac454d951cedc64012ce0e37feb3d0e779029c84cc634720dc6db3232ba:0
- value
- 1787666
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4fc886af53e35d910a694dcc8462081009a605e6 OP_EQUAL
- address
- 38xsXVmw2QokrZiu1hZJhxnCAS6UjZmchr